Halp! I installed your patch in my existing game and Dagri'Lon is still missing his hood.
This plugin changes the outfits of Dagri'Lon and five other hooded characters from iNPC, but if you've already met them (specifically, been in the same cell as them) at least once before in an existing save before installing this mod, then the old hoodless outfit will have already been distributed to them. You can, however, manually give them WACCF's separate hood. Below are instructions on how to do that for Dagri'Lon:
1.) Open up the console and select Dagri'Lon. You should see his ID displayed as xx0323B8, where xx is the load order for the iNPCs plugin. 1a.) Bonus step: consider installing Console Commands Extender. It's a SKSE plugin that, among other features, highlights whatever you've selected with the console. 2.) Type in "help CCF_ClothesMonkHood_Black 4" and look for an ARMO record with that name in your search results. The other hood colors are named similarly, with green/blue/etc. in place of "black." The hood you'll need has an ID of yy001DAA, where yy is the load order for WACCF's plugin. 3.) Type in "EquipItem yy001DAA" to make Dagri'Lon equip WACCF's standalone black hood.

The Creation Kit... now that's a name I haven't heard in a long time. I actually made this plugin entirely in xEdit, as I avoid using the CK wherever possible. By the sounds of it, the CK takes umbrage with my description being longer than 512 characters, and automatically trimmed off anything past that. This is a harmless "error" that the Kit, for some reason, decided we needed to see.
There's nothing you'll need to do: the Creation Kit is just jumping at digital shadows, at it has always done. It throws dozens of errors like this even for Bethesda's own original plugins, and we need only click "Yes to All" to get it to kindly shut up. Most importantly, this almost certainly won't interfere with the plugin working in the actual game.
